1. There are many different types of muscle building supplements on the market today.
2. Some of the most popular muscle building supplements include whey protein, creatine, and nitric oxide.
3. Supplements can help you build muscle by providing your body with the nutrients it needs to repair and grow muscle tissue.
4. Muscle building supplements can also help you recover from your workouts more quickly.
5. Creatine is one of the most studied muscle building supplements and has been shown to be effective in increasing muscle size and strength.
6. Nitric oxide supplements can help increase blood flow to your muscles, which can help you lift heavier weights and improve your muscle pumps.
7. Whey protein is a popular muscle building supplement because it is a complete protein that contains all of the essential amino acids your body needs to build muscle.

To increase muscle mass in combination with physical activity, it is recommended that a person that lifts weights regularly or is training for a running or cycling event eat a range of 1.2-1.7 grams of protein per kilogram of body weight per day, or 0.5 to 0.8 grams per pound of body weight.

No, you can still build muscle and get stronger without supplementing with creatine by relying on a progressive resistance training program and a diet rich in natural sources of creatine.
